Crystal Reports For Microsoft Great Plains
|
Microsoft Business Solutions ? Great Plains is designed to meet and extend the needs of small and mid-size organizations for its business success. Its comprehensive accounting and business management applications also provide businesses with capabilities to customize various modules of the Great Plains software to fit to their specific needs. Because of these potentials, Great Plains has been targeted to the whole spectrum of both horizontal and vertical clientele.
A number of industry-specific applications integrate well with Great Plains. This allows for more flexibility and unparalleled access to information that aids in decision-making and analysis of performance.
Crystal Reports is a report-writing software that can integrate itself to Great Plains' database. It goes beyond the report creation process of Great Plains' own Report Writer. As a developer, Crystal Reports will help your client access decision-driving information to aid in managing their businesses more effectively. So, how do we use Crystal Reports to extend Great Plains Report Writer?
Great Plains Table Structure
When a business entity is processed, the information is written onto the Great Plains database tables. This can be found by launching Great Plains, then: Tools > Resource Description > Tables. Find the appropriate Table:
RM00101 ? Customer Master File
SOP30200 ? Sales History Header File
Create ODBC Connection
Open Database Connectivity (ODBC) is an integration tool to connect a client application to an ODBC-compliant database. It allows exchanging information among databases and easily integrates with a wide range of present systems. Great Plains uses the ODBC drivers installed by Microsoft SQL Server.
To create an ODBC connection to a Great Plains company database, one common way is with the use of the Data Source dialog box. It prompts you to connect to the appropriate data source. Choose the company database that you are targeting that contains the data needed for your Crystal Reports report generation.
SQL Views
Microsoft SQL Server has a virtual table that you can access to minimize the complexity of looking at links in Crystal Reports itself. By referencing the view name in a Transact-SQL statement, a user can access this virtual table and retrieve the data for future selection to be applied into Crystal Reports.
SQL Stored Procedures
There are instances wherein you will not be able to pull all your needed data into one view. In this situation, you would need an SQL stored-procedure ? defined as a group of Transact-SQL statements compiled into a single execution plan. With the help of a stored procedure, you do not need to access individual tables to use in Crystal Reports.
Calling Crystal Reports via VBA/Modifier
It is possible to call the Crystal Reports engine from one Great Plains application to do a process with the use of Modifier and VBA. For example, you want to print a Crystal Reports invoice in Great Plains from the Sales Order Processing window, use Modifier and VBA to call up the Crystal Reports engine.
SQL Query
Using SQL Query Analyzer can help in making sure you are getting adequate results in your report generation. In addition, it debugs stored procedures and query performance problems. It can also copy existing database objects and locate, view or work with these objects within the database.
Need more information?
Contact us: 1-866-528-0577 or help@albaspectrum.com
For customization work and advice, please contact Andrew Karasev, Alba Spectrum Chief Technology Officer. His works include development of applications with the use of Dexterity, SQL, C# .NET, Crystal Reports and Microsoft CRM SDK.
Divine Rigor is the Technical Writer for Alba Spectrum Technologies USA ( http://www.albaspectrum.com ), a Great Plains, Microsoft CRM customization company. We are based in Chicago with locations in California, Arizona, Texas, Florida, Georgia, New York and contacts in international markets.
© Jan 2005 Alba Spectrum Technologies USA
|
|
|
Freedos
Before September 1995, Microsoft Windows was an MS-DOS program. DOS was an easy to use command line operating system that provided you with complete ability to control and troubleshoot your computer. Microsoft's goal was to eliminate DOS, possibly to prevent you from having complete control of your own computer.The last stand-alone version of MS-DOS was version 6. Unfortunately, that version is not Y2K compliant. Windows 95 and later came with MS-DOS version 7. Unfortunately, that version is too integrated with the operating system. It wi...(related: Software)
Microsoft Great Plains - Microsoft Rms Integration ? Overview
Microsoft Great Plains and Microsoft Retail Management System (Microsoft RMS) are originally developed by different software vendors, who had no idea that in the remote future (now) these two applications will be owned by Microsoft and will need to be tightly integrated. Current integration between the two is not an easy thing. At this time MBS has RMS integration on the General Ledger and Purchase Order level into Great Plains out of the box. This integration has some advancements in comparison to old product: QuickSell, but it is still GL and PO only. We ...(related: Software)
Causes Of Erp Failures
ERP is the acronym of Enterprise Resource Planning. Multi-module ERP software integrates business activities across various functional departments, from product planning, parts purchasing, inventory control, product distribution, to order tracking. ERP has transformed the way multi-billion dollar corporations conduct their businesses. Successful implementation of ERP systems could save tens of millions of dollars and increase employee satisfactions, customer satisfactions and sustain competitive advantages in every-changing marketplace. Corporate executives are often perplexed by the stories that how reputable corporations (Hershey Foods, etc.) have failed miserably and lost ten of millions of dollars in their ERP endures.The failures of ERP projects are preventable if we can id...(related: Software)
Microsoft Great Plains Br: Bank Reconciliation
Microsoft Business Solutions Great Plains is marketed for mid-size companies as well as Navision (which has very good positions in Europe and emerging markets where it can be easily localized).
Great Plains Bank Reconciliation (BR) module lets you manage all of your bank-related activity through a single automated intersection, including cash, check, and credit card transactions, bank account balances, and automated reconciliation.
BR extends your reconciliation capabilities with ease using customizable transaction views, summaries of important information, historical balance inquiries, and easy-to-use tools to sort and mark transactions as you need. Empower your employees with a str...(related: Software)
Microsoft Great Plains, Navision, Axapta ? Selection Considerations
During the years of our consulting practice, which comes back to East Europe in mid 1990th and then continues in the USA, Brazil, New Zealand, Australia, Oceania, Germany, Canada ? we would like to orient you ? business owner, IT director or software programmer. Selection proces...(related: Software)
Groupware And Version History: Collaboration Series #1
This article is the first of a series of articles exploring specific aspects of groupware. The brief informational articles in this series discuss some of the technologies associated with groupware, as well as some of the characteristics of groupware. Some of these characteristics may go hand in hand with business collaborative needs. Other characteristics go beyond what some groupware providers have to offer. The purpose of these articles is to equip the groupware user or investigator with helpful knowledge about the product in order to enable more effective use or to lead the investigator to the groupware service he or she is looking for. This first article explores Version History, a service that can be provided in groupw...(related: Software)
The Religion And Philosophy Of Small Internet Business
I have always had a tendency to focus on the positive. We, all of us, know the negative details in society and governments. So why not focus on solutions? Most self-actualized grownups even solve problems in this manner.Chances are we'll always have the mammoth corporations. Large corporations have their good and bad points. Click? Want to strike back at the aristocracy? Develop and advertise a business website. And it does not matter what country you are from e...(related: Software)
An Easy Way To Develop Java Enterprise Applications
Research bears that less than 70 percent of development projects are actually completed, and mo...(related: Software)
An Easy Way To Deal With Email Viruses And Worms
If you feel intimidated when someone tries to teach you something new on the computer, this article is for you!In the course of my career, I've worked with many people who I knew were smart but were convinced that they couldn't learn how to do new things on a computer. At some point, they'd convinced themselves that they weren't one of those "computer people". I would try to teach them how to do something that would make their work a lot easier or faster, and I could see them shut down immediately. "I can't do stuff like that. I'm just not good ...(related: Software)
Preventive Maintenance Software Companies
Several software companies design programs for preventive maintenance. Most of the preventive maintenance software companies produce programs for facilities and businesses. Because many programs are adaptable, they can be used for different types of facilities. Some of the best know preventive ...(related: Software)
site-map - Copyright © 2008 | Contact Webmaster | All Rights Reserved. | Software